Jamie Scott has prosecuted a man for multiple charges relating to the promotion of racial hatred online.
Over the course of a year, the defendant had posted from multiple accounts on X racist and anti-Semitic memes, slurs and threats, intending to stir up racial hatred. He had been referred to the Prevent strategy four times in the previous decade to prevent his radicalisation by extreme rightwing ideology. The defendant’s prosecution was precipitated by his identification in an exposé BBC documentary about far right groups.
He was sentenced to two years’ imprisonment at Warwick Crown Court.
